Sono Bana Japanese Restaurant

Good Food at a Good Price

Sono Bana Japanese Restaurant, formerly Hama, located on 1206 Dixwell Ave., has been part of the Hamden scene since 1986.

Upon entering, its casual Japanese motif, will invite any hungry visitor to come in and sit down. The quiet light blue walls compliment the Bamboo booth décor to make any visit calming and enjoyable. Origami folded napkins completes the authentic atmosphere.

Sono Bana was voted to have the best sushi by the Yale (University) Herald in 2010. It's a very popular place for students from surrounding college campuses to get what is considered both the best sushi and the best value in the New Haven area. They were voted the best Japanese restaurant by the New Haven Advocate Readers’ Poll for 2001, 2002, 2003 and 2005, and was honored in the Connecticut Magazine Readers’ Choice Poll.

Sono Bana offers a prix fixed menu special for eat-in only. A three course meal consisting of an appetizer, entrée and dessert of your choice served with soup and salad is offered for $20. If you are watching your pocket book, order from the lunch and dinner box menu for an economic treat, or choose from their list of more than 20 specialty rolls. They are always adding to their list be sure to call ahead to see what is new.

They offer Happy Hour everyday from 4:30 – 6 p.m., a little different then a regular offering of alcoholic drinks only. They offer a special of an appetizer and a sushi roll with your choice of wine, beer or Saki.
